aboutsummaryrefslogtreecommitdiffstats
path: root/main/dns.c
diff options
context:
space:
mode:
Diffstat (limited to 'main/dns.c')
-rw-r--r--main/dns.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/main/dns.c b/main/dns.c
index 3599de2c5..efb2e4475 100644
--- a/main/dns.c
+++ b/main/dns.c
@@ -216,7 +216,11 @@ int ast_search_dns(void *context,
ret = 1;
}
#if HAVE_RES_NINIT
+#if HAVE_RES_NDESTROY
+ res_ndestroy(&dnsstate);
+#else
res_nclose(&dnsstate);
+#endif
#else
#ifndef __APPLE__
res_close();